At this year’sCinemaCon, whereScreenRantis in attendance, Sony officially confirmed thatSpider-Man: Beyond the Spider-Versewill be hitting theaters on August 20, 2025. A brief clip was also shown during the announcement:

Aaron Davis and Miles Morales in Spider-Man Across the Spider-Verse

Lots of voiceovers and snippets from the previous film — Miles’ dad, uncle, mother, Gwen. It’s a stylistic opening of clips from previous films in a very colorful montage. Miles says, “Everyone keeps telling me how my story is supposed to go…I’mma do my own thing.”

The Spider-Verse 3 sizzle preview focuses on Miles and Gwen as they are riding a motorcycle. The Spot is seen sucking colors from the environments, with the footage also confirming that he is now able to also transform himself into an arachnid-like being, showing him crawling against the web-slingers. Miles and his Earth-42 counterpart, Miles G. Morales aka The Prowler, are working together, with the preview teasing more about their dynamic in the movie. The two versions of Miles are also teaming up with Uncle Aaron.

However, that is not all, asChristopher Miller, one of the main producers and writers of theSpider-Versetrilogy, also took to X to celebrate the news by revealingnew images fromSpider-Man: Beyond the Spider-Verse. Check them out below:

TheSpider-Man: Beyond the Spider-Verseimages include both versions of Miles in their respective costumes, and the main version of the Marvel icon together with Gwen Stacy.Spider-Man: Beyond the Spider-Versewill be directed by Bob Persichetti and Justin K. Thompson, based on a script by Miller, Phil Lord, and David Callaham.

What Spider-Man: Beyond The Spider-Verse’s Release Date Means

WithSpider-Man: Beyond the Spider-Verseofficially being slotted for June 2027,it confirms that Sony is confident enough that they will have production finished on the third film by that time. With the unique animation style that comes with theSpider-Versemovies, the 2027 date makes perfect sense forSpider-Man: Beyond the Spider-Verse. Not only will it give the animation team time to properly master their product, but with theories that there may also belive-action elements inSpider-Man: Beyond the Spider-Verse, the timetable is adding up.

However, while studios have yet to unveil their full 2027 releases,Spider-Man: Beyond the Spider-Versewill be coming out only a month after Marvel Studios’Avengers: Secret Wars, another massive Marvel multiverse-based story. As of right now,Avengers: Secret WarsisSpider-Man: Beyond the Spider-Verse’sbiggest competition, though more movies will be slated in the coming months. While likely not intentional, May and June 2027 will both see the end of two massive Marvel multiverse arcs.
